Retë hibride: një udhëzues për pilotët fillestarë

Retë hibride: një udhëzues për pilotët fillestarë

Përshëndetje, Khabrovites! Sipas statistikave, tregu i shërbimeve cloud në Rusi po fiton vazhdimisht forcë. Retë hibride janë në trend më shumë se kurrë - pavarësisht faktit se vetë teknologjia është larg nga e reja. Shumë kompani po pyesin se sa e realizueshme është të mirëmbahet dhe mirëmbahet një flotë e madhe harduerësh, duke përfshirë atë që nevojitet për situatën, në formën e një reje private.

Sot do të flasim se në cilat situata përdorimi i një reje hibride do të jetë një hap i justifikuar dhe në të cilat mund të krijojë probleme. Artikulli do të jetë i dobishëm për ata që nuk kanë pasur më parë përvojë serioze duke punuar me retë hibride, por tashmë po i shikojnë ato dhe nuk dinë nga të fillojnë.

Në fund të artikullit, ne do të ofrojmë një listë kontrolli me truket që do t'ju ndihmojnë kur zgjidhni një ofrues cloud dhe vendosni një re hibride.

Lusim të gjithë të interesuarit që të kalojnë nën prerje!

Re private kundrejt publikut: të mirat dhe të këqijat

Për të kuptuar se cilat arsye po i shtyjnë bizneset të kalojnë në hibride, le të shohim tiparet kryesore të reve publike dhe private. Le të përqendrohemi, para së gjithash, në ato aspekte që në një mënyrë ose në një tjetër shqetësojnë shumicën e kompanive. Për të shmangur konfuzionin në terminologji, ne paraqesim më poshtë përkufizimet kryesore:

Re private (ose private). është një infrastrukturë IT, përbërësit e së cilës ndodhen brenda një kompanie dhe vetëm në pajisjet në pronësi të kësaj kompanie ose ofruesi të cloud.

Re publike është një mjedis IT, pronari i të cilit ofron shërbime kundrejt tarifës dhe ofron hapësirë ​​në cloud për të gjithë.

Re hibride përbëhet nga më shumë se një re private dhe më shumë se një re publike, fuqia llogaritëse e së cilës është e përbashkët.

Retë private

Pavarësisht kostos së lartë, reja private ka disa përparësi që nuk mund të injorohen. Këto përfshijnë kontrollueshmëri të lartë, siguri të të dhënave dhe monitorim të plotë të funksionimit të burimeve dhe pajisjeve. Përafërsisht, një re private plotëson të gjitha idetë e inxhinierëve për një infrastrukturë ideale. Në çdo kohë mund të rregulloni arkitekturën e resë kompjuterike, të ndryshoni vetitë dhe konfigurimin e saj.

Nuk ka nevojë të mbështeteni te ofruesit e jashtëm - të gjithë komponentët e infrastrukturës mbeten në anën tuaj.

Por, pavarësisht argumenteve të forta në favor, një re private mund të jetë shumë e shtrenjtë në fillim dhe në mirëmbajtjen e mëvonshme. Tashmë në fazën e projektimit të një reje private, është e nevojshme të llogaritni saktë ngarkesën e ardhshme... Kursimi në fillim mund të çojë në faktin se herët a vonë do të përballeni me mungesën e burimeve dhe nevojën për rritje. Dhe shkallëzimi i një reje private është një proces kompleks dhe i shtrenjtë. Sa herë që duhet të blini pajisje të reja, lidheni dhe konfiguroni ato, dhe kjo shpesh mund të zgjasë me javë - kundrejt shkallëzimit pothuajse të menjëhershëm në renë publike.

Përveç kostove të pajisjeve, është e nevojshme të sigurohen burime financiare për licencat dhe personelin.

Në disa raste, bilanci “çmim/cilësi”, ose më saktë “kostoja e shkallëzimit dhe mirëmbajtjes/përfitimet e marra”, më në fund zhvendoset drejt çmimit.

Retë publike

Nëse zotëroni vetëm një re private, atëherë një re publike i përket një ofruesi të jashtëm i cili ju lejon të përdorni burimet e tij kompjuterike për një tarifë.

Në të njëjtën kohë, gjithçka që lidhet me mbështetjen dhe mirëmbajtjen e cloud bie mbi supet e "ofruesit" të fuqishëm. Detyra juaj është të zgjidhni planin tarifor optimal dhe të bëni pagesat në kohë.

Përdorimi i një reje publike për projekte relativisht të vogla është shumë më lirë sesa të mirëmbani flotën tuaj të pajisjeve.

Prandaj, nuk ka nevojë të mirëmbahen specialistë të IT-së dhe rreziqet financiare reduktohen.

Në çdo kohë, ju jeni të lirë të ndryshoni ofruesin e cloud dhe të zhvendoseni në një vend më të përshtatshëm ose më fitimprurës.

Sa i përket disavantazheve të reve publike, gjithçka këtu është mjaft e pritshme: shumë më pak kontroll nga ana e klientit, performancë më e ulët gjatë përpunimit të vëllimeve të mëdha të të dhënave dhe siguri e ulët e të dhënave në krahasim me ato private, të cilat mund të jenë kritike për disa lloje biznesi. .

retë hibride

Në kryqëzimin e avantazheve dhe disavantazheve të mësipërme janë retë hibride, të cilat janë de fakto një kombinim i të paktën një reje private me një ose më shumë ato publike. Në shikim të parë (dhe madje edhe në të dytën), mund të duket se një re hibride është guri filozofik që ju lejon të "fryni" fuqinë llogaritëse në çdo kohë, të kryeni llogaritjet e nevojshme dhe "të fryni" gjithçka prapa. Jo një re, por David Blaine!

Retë hibride: një udhëzues për pilotët fillestarë

Në realitet, gjithçka është pothuajse po aq e bukur sa në teori: reja hibride kursen kohë dhe para, ka shumë raste përdorimi standarde dhe jo standarde... por ka nuanca. Këtu janë ato më të rëndësishmet:

Së pari, është e nevojshme të lidhni saktë renë "tuaj" dhe "të dikujt tjetër", duke përfshirë edhe performancën. Këtu mund të lindin shumë probleme, veçanërisht nëse qendra publike e të dhënave cloud është fizikisht e largët ose e ndërtuar mbi një teknologji tjetër. Në këtë rast, ekziston një rrezik i lartë i vonesave, ndonjëherë kritike.

Në radhë të dytë, përdorimi i një reje hibride si një infrastrukturë për një aplikacion të vetëm është i mbushur me performancë të pabarabartë në të gjitha frontet (nga CPU në nënsistemin e diskut) dhe tolerancë të reduktuar ndaj gabimeve. Dy serverë me të njëjtat parametra, por të vendosur në segmente të ndryshme, do të tregojnë performancë të ndryshme.

Së treti, mos harroni për dobësitë e harduerit të harduerit "të huaj" (përshëndetje të zjarrta për arkitektët Intel) dhe probleme të tjera të sigurisë në pjesën publike të cloud, të përmendura tashmë më lart.

Së katërti, përdorimi i një reje hibride kërcënon të reduktojë ndjeshëm tolerancën e gabimeve nëse pret një aplikacion të vetëm.

Bonus special: tani dy re në vend të njërës dhe/ose lidhja midis tyre mund të "prishet" menjëherë. Dhe në shumë kombinime në të njëjtën kohë.

Më vete, vlen të përmenden problemet e pritjes së aplikacioneve të mëdha në një re hibride.
Në shumicën dërrmuese të rasteve, nuk mund të shkosh dhe të marrësh, për shembull, 100 makina virtuale me 128 GB RAM në renë publike. Më shpesh, askush nuk do t'ju japë as 10 makina të tilla.

Retë hibride: një udhëzues për pilotët fillestarë

Po, retë publike nuk janë gome, Moskë. Shumë ofrues thjesht nuk mbajnë një rezervë të tillë të kapacitetit të lirë - dhe kjo ka të bëjë kryesisht me RAM-in. Ju mund të "vizatoni" aq bërthama procesori sa të doni dhe mund të siguroni shumë herë më shumë kapacitet SSD ose HDD sesa është fizikisht i disponueshëm. Ofruesi do të shpresojë që të mos e përdorni të gjithë volumin menjëherë dhe se do të jetë e mundur ta rrisni atë gjatë rrugës. Por nëse nuk ka RAM të mjaftueshëm, makina virtuale ose aplikacioni mund të rrëzohet lehtësisht. Dhe sistemi i virtualizimit nuk lejon gjithmonë truket e tilla. Në çdo rast, ia vlen të kujtoni këtë zhvillim të ngjarjeve dhe t'i diskutoni këto pika me ofruesin "onshore", përndryshe rrezikoni të mbeteni pas gjatë ngarkesave të pikut (e premtja e zezë, ngarkesa sezonale, etj.).

Si përmbledhje, nëse doni të përdorni një infrastrukturë hibride, mbani në mend se:

  • Ofruesi nuk është gjithmonë i gatshëm të sigurojë kapacitetin e nevojshëm sipas kërkesës.
  • Ka probleme dhe vonesa në lidhjen e elementeve. Ju duhet të kuptoni se cilat pjesë të infrastrukturës dhe në cilat raste do të bëjnë kërkesa përmes "bashkimit"; kjo mund të ndikojë në performancën dhe disponueshmërinë. Është më mirë të merret në konsideratë që në re nuk ka një nyje grupi, por një pjesë të veçantë dhe të pavarur të infrastrukturës.
  • Ekziston rreziku i shfaqjes së problemeve në pjesë të mëdha të peizazhit. Në një zgjidhje hibride, njëra ose tjetra re mund të "bien" tërësisht. Në rastin e një grupi të rregullt virtualizimi, rrezikoni të humbni më së shumti një server, por këtu rrezikoni të humbni shumë menjëherë, brenda natës.
  • Gjëja më e sigurt për të bërë është ta trajtoni pjesën publike jo si një "zgjerues", por si një re të veçantë në një qendër të veçantë të dhënash. Vërtetë, në këtë rast ju në fakt injoroni "hibriditetin" e zgjidhjes.

Zbutja e disavantazheve të një reje hibride

Në fakt, fotografia është shumë më e këndshme sesa mund të mendoni. Gjëja më e rëndësishme është të dini truket e "gatimit" të një reje të mirë hibride. Këtu janë ato kryesore në formatin e listës së kontrollit:

  • Ju nuk duhet të zhvendosni pjesët e aplikacionit të ndjeshme ndaj vonesës në renë publike veçmas nga programi kryesor: për shembull, cache ose bazat e të dhënave nën ngarkesën OLTP.
  • Mos i vendosni tërësisht ato pjesë të aplikacionit në renë publike, pa të cilat ai do të ndalojë së punuari. Përndryshe, probabiliteti i dështimit të sistemit do të rritet disa herë.
  • Kur shkallëzoni, mbani në mend se performanca e makinerive të vendosura në pjesë të ndryshme të resë kompjuterike do të ndryshojë. Fleksibiliteti i shkallëzimit gjithashtu nuk do të jetë i përsosur. Fatkeqësisht, ky është një problem i projektimit arkitektonik dhe nuk do të jeni në gjendje ta zhdukni plotësisht atë. Mund të përpiqeni vetëm të zvogëloni ndikimin e tij në punë.
  • Mundohuni të siguroni afërsinë maksimale fizike midis reve publike dhe private: sa më e shkurtër të jetë distanca, aq më të ulëta do të jenë vonesat ndërmjet segmenteve. Në mënyrë ideale, të dyja pjesët e resë "jetojnë" në të njëjtën qendër të dhënash.
  • Është po aq e rëndësishme të sigurohet që të dy retë përdorin teknologji të njëjta rrjeti. Portat Ethernet-InfiniBand mund të paraqesin shumë probleme.
  • Nëse e njëjta teknologji virtualizimi përdoret në retë private dhe publike, ky është një plus i caktuar. Në disa raste, mund të bini dakord me ofruesin për të migruar të gjitha makinat virtuale pa riinstalim.
  • Për ta bërë përdorimin e një reje hibride fitimprurëse, zgjidhni një ofrues cloud me çmimet më fleksibël. Më e mira nga të gjitha, bazuar në burimet e përdorura në të vërtetë.
  • Rriteni me qendrat e të dhënave: nëse keni nevojë për të rritur kapacitetin, ne ngremë një "qendër të dytë të të dhënave" dhe e vendosim nën ngarkesë. A keni mbaruar me llogaritjet tuaja? Ne "shumë" fuqinë e tepërt dhe kursejmë.
  • Aplikacionet dhe projektet individuale mund të zhvendosen në renë publike ndërsa reja private është duke u shkallëzuar, ose thjesht për një periudhë të caktuar. Vërtetë, në këtë rast nuk do të keni hibriditet, vetëm lidhje të përgjithshme L2, e cila nuk varet në asnjë mënyrë nga prania/mungesa e resë suaj.

Në vend të një përfundimi

Kjo eshte e gjitha. Ne folëm për veçoritë e reve private dhe publike dhe shikuam mundësitë kryesore për përmirësimin e performancës dhe besueshmërisë së reve hibride. Megjithatë, dizajni i çdo reje kompjuterike është rezultat i vendimeve, kompromiseve dhe konventave të diktuara nga objektivat dhe burimet e biznesit të kompanisë.

Qëllimi ynë është të motivojmë lexuesin që të marrë seriozisht zgjedhjen e infrastrukturës së përshtatshme cloud bazuar në qëllimet e tij, teknologjitë e disponueshme dhe aftësitë financiare.

Ju ftojmë të ndani përvojën tuaj me retë hibride në komente. Jemi të sigurt se ekspertiza juaj do të jetë e dobishme për shumë pilotë fillestarë.

Burimi: www.habr.com

Shto një koment